The Dental Plugger Gap Plugger, Distal Angle Acc. Deppeler Sample, Figure 4, M4X0.5 is a precision-engineered single-ended instrument developed in collaboration with Dr. Hürzeler and Dr. Zuhr, and manufactured by Helmut Zepf GmbH in Germany to exacting clinical standards.
Key Features
- Design: Single-ended configuration with a distal angle tip geometry based on the Deppeler Sample, Figure 4
- Thread Specification: M4X0.5
- Collaboration: Developed by Dr. Hürzeler and Dr. Zuhr, reflecting refined clinical instrumentation philosophy
- TOUCHGRIP Design: Engineered for secure grip, tactile feedback, and reduced hand fatigue during procedures
- Manufacturer: Helmut Zepf GmbH — Made in Germany
TOUCHGRIP Design
The TOUCHGRIP Design is a hallmark of the Hürzeler/Zuhr instrument series. This Dental Plugger benefits from a thoughtfully contoured handle that promotes precise force application and optimal clinician control. The surface texture and weight distribution are tailored to meet demanding procedural requirements, reducing fatigue and improving tactile sensitivity throughout extended clinical use.
